CMOS

Complementary metal–oxide–semiconductor (CMOS /ˈsiːmɒs/ SEE-moss) is a type of metal–oxide–semiconductor field-effect transistor (MOSFET) fabrication process that uses complementary and symmetrical pairs of p-type and n-type MOSFETs for logic functions.
